Key Statistics:
- In the UK, the healthcare sector employs over 1.5 million people, making it one of the largest industries in the country.
- According to the Office for National Statistics, the number of people aged 65 and over is projected to grow by 20% in the next decade, increasing the demand for health and social care services.
- Research by Skills for Care shows that there are over 1.5 million jobs in adult social care in England alone, with an estimated 340,000 job vacancies at any given time.

Course Content
• Understanding the principles of health and social care
• Promoting health and well-being
• Equality, diversity, and rights in health and social care
• Health and safety in health and social care settings
• Personal and professional development in health and social care
• Safeguarding and protection in health and social care
• Communication in health and social care
• Working in partnership in health and social care
• Understanding mental well-being
• Understanding substance misuse
